The IRWIN IR59200CD is a Handi-Clamp with a 2-inch (50mm) jaw capacity, designed for securing workpieces during cutting, gluing, welding, and general fabrication tasks. This compact clamp delivers quick one-handed operation, making it a practical choice for tradespeople and contractors who need reliable holding force in tight spaces. Sold individually, the IR59200CD is a go-to hand tool for HVAC sheet metal work, pipe staging, carpentry rough-in, and light assembly applications where a small-profile clamp is needed.
The IR59200CD suits residential and light commercial trade work across multiple disciplines. HVAC technicians use small clamps like this during ductwork fabrication and sheet metal layout. Plumbers and pipefitters use them to hold pipe sections during fitting and soldering. Electricians and general contractors reach for them during conduit bending staging and cabinet assembly. The 2-inch capacity keeps this clamp well-suited for small-diameter stock and thin material workholding.
Designed as a general-purpose hand clamp suitable for light fabrication, assembly, and staging tasks across HVAC, plumbing, electrical, and carpentry trades.
No power source or trade license is required to use this clamp. Inspect jaw pads before each use to avoid marring finished surfaces. Do not exceed the rated jaw capacity to prevent clamp failure or workpiece damage. Store in a dry location to prevent corrosion of the clamping mechanism.
